The Growing Popularity of Fitness Apps in the Philippines
Over the past ten years, more and more people in the Philippines have started using smartphones. This has led to a big increase in the popularity of mobile apps, including those focused on fitness. These apps are designed for all kinds of people, offering things like workout plans made just for you, advice on what to eat, and a way to connect with others for support. They’re helping to bring technology and healthy living together.
According to a report from Statista, there will likely be more than 5 million people in the Philippines using fitness apps by 2025. This shows that there’s a big chance for developers and business owners to create apps that really help Filipinos with their specific health challenges. The growing market also means that people are becoming more aware of how important it is to stay healthy, especially when many of us spend a lot of time sitting down.
Cool New Features in Fitness Apps
As technology gets better, so do the things that fitness apps can do. Here are some of the most exciting new features that are changing the future of health and fitness in the Philippines:
1. Connecting with Wearable Devices
Wearable devices, like smartwatches and fitness trackers, are now a common sight in the fitness world. They collect information about your activities, heart rate, sleep, and more. Fitness apps can easily connect to these devices, letting you see your health stats in real-time. Apps like MyFitnessPal and Strava use this to give you a complete picture of your health, which helps you set goals and track your progress. The global wearable fitness tracker market was valued at $45.26 billion in 2022. This demonstrates the increasing consumer interest in combining technology with fitness.
2. Personalized Help with AI
Artificial Intelligence (AI) is changing how fitness apps help each person individually. By looking at your data, AI can create workout plans and food suggestions that are just right for you. For example, some Filipino fitness apps use AI to change your routines based on how you’re doing and what you like, making it more likely that you’ll stick to your goals.
3. Working Out in Virtual Reality (VR)
Virtual Reality is becoming a cool way to train. It lets you feel like you’re really in the workout, which can make you more motivated and engaged. Some Filipino startups are starting to add VR to their fitness programs, letting you join workout classes or training sessions in a virtual world. This can be really helpful in cities where it’s not always easy to get to gyms.
4. Building Communities and Connecting with Others
Fitness apps are now focusing on features that bring people together, letting you connect with others, share your successes, and encourage each other. Being part of a community can help you feel responsible and motivated. Apps like Fitbit have social challenges that let you compete with friends and family, making fitness more fun and less lonely.
How Fitness Apps Help Public Health
When fitness apps become part of our daily lives, they can really improve public health in the Philippines. Here are some ways they make a difference:
1. Making Fitness More Accessible
Fitness apps are an easy way for people to get health and wellness information right on their phones. This makes fitness more available to everyone, giving anyone with a smartphone access to knowledge and tools that used to be only for those who could afford gym memberships or personal trainers.
2. Teaching About Health and Wellness
Many fitness apps include information that helps you understand the basics of health, nutrition, and exercise. This knowledge can help you make better choices every day. For example, apps often have blogs and articles about common health issues in the Philippines, like obesity and high blood pressure.
3. Supporting Changes in Behavior
By letting you track your habits and set goals, fitness apps can help you change your behavior. Seeing your progress can motivate you to stick with your fitness plan. Plus, many apps send reminders and notifications to encourage you to stay consistent.
4. Providing Support During Difficult Times
The COVID-19 pandemic showed us how important health and fitness are, especially when lockdowns made it hard to stay active. Fitness apps stepped in to offer virtual workout classes, nutrition advice, and social support. They helped people take care of their minds and bodies during a tough time.
Challenges to Keep in Mind
Even with all the good things about fitness apps in the Philippines, there are some challenges to consider:
1. The Digital Divide
Not everyone in the Philippines has the same access to smartphones or fast internet. This means that some people might not be able to use fitness apps. It’s important to find other ways to share health information and fitness solutions to make sure everyone is included. According to data from Statista, internet penetration rate in the Philippines was at 76.3% in 2023; this implies that while a majority have access, a significant portion of the population remain excluded.
2. Too Much Information
With so many fitness apps available, it can be hard to choose the right one. People might feel confused and unsure of what to do. There needs to be clear advice and recommendations to help people pick the best apps for their needs.
3. Data Privacy and Security
When we rely more on apps, we need to think about data privacy. People need to know that their personal and health information is safe and used in the right way. Fitness app developers need to follow strict privacy rules to earn the trust of their users.
What’s Next for Fitness Apps in the Philippines
To really make the most of fitness apps in the Philippines, we need to focus on a few key things:
1. Working with Health Organizations
When fitness app developers and health organizations work together, they can create helpful resources for users. Programs that combine medical advice and fitness plans for specific health conditions can improve overall health.
2. Making Apps More Engaging
Continuing to improve the user experience can help people stay interested in fitness apps. Adding game-like features, offering rewards, and creating personalized experiences can motivate users to stick with their fitness goals.
3. Creating Content for Locals
Changing fitness content to fit local cultures, foods, and fitness practices can make apps more relatable and useful for Filipino users. This localization can make the apps more effective and lead to better health results.
Fitness app developers can partner with local nutritionists and chefs to include traditional Filipino recipes with healthy twists. Apps can also showcase popular local exercises, like “tinikling” dances adapted into cardio workouts, to resonate more with users.
